Overview
- Carmen Geiss announced the injury and upcoming neurosurgical treatment in a personal Instagram post that included a hospital selfie.
- She said she fell on a staircase at home with her hands full and hit her right side without braking.
- According to her account, doctors identified a hematoma measuring about 10 centimeters in length and 11 millimeters in thickness that requires operative treatment.
- Geiss voiced confidence in her medical team and highlighted support from her family and fans.
- Media report that key details remain unknown, including the surgery date, the treatment location, and whether there are additional injuries.
